On 08/07/2022 09:51, Hamza Khan wrote:
> Currently, when vm_power_manager exits, we are using a LIST_FOREACH
> macro to iterate over VM info structures while freeing them. This
> leads to use-after-free error. To address this, replace all usages of
> LIST_* with TAILQ_* macros, and use the RTE_TAILQ_FOREACH_SAFE macro
> to iterate and delete VM info structures.
